This is an easy and small confidence-building Spanish reader about the tragedy of violent gang life in the deadly pandillas (gangs) formed by immigrants from El Salvador that have moved to Los Angeles and elsewhere, called La Mara Salvatrucha, or MS-13.  It has a FABULOUS glossary in the back to help you with any words you do not recognize!  You will review all verb tenses, vocabulary, and build confidence in your abilities as you use them to pull together all the grammar you have studied in your first four years of Spanish while learning about the origins of this pandilla. This Spanish reader uses an educational strategy called comprehensible input, where students build confidence in their abilities and review verb structures through use in a simple text with excellent support in the glossary.
